Benefits of Rotomolding Chairs in Lightweight and Durable Design

Rotomolding chairs are a remarkable blend of lightweight and durable design. They offer exceptional maneuverability for spaces requiring versatile seating solutions. Their construction ensures that they can withstand a variety of environmental conditions, making them ideal for both indoor and outdoor usage. The unique molding process gives these chairs a seamless finish, eliminating sharp edges and enhancing safety. Users appreciate the comfort provided by the ergonomic design, which is essential for extended periods of sitting.

When selecting rotomolding chairs, consider the weight capacity and stability. It's crucial to ensure that the chair can support various body types without compromising safety. Additionally, examine the color options available. These chairs can often be customized to match specific aesthetic requirements. Look for UV resistance if the chairs will be used outdoors, as this extends the product's lifespan.

Cleaning and maintenance are often overlooked aspects. Many rotomolding chairs are easy to clean, requiring just a damp cloth. However, it's important to reflect on the long-term effects of exposure to harsh cleaning agents. Opt for gentle cleaning solutions to maintain their integrity. Regular inspections for cracks or any signs of wear are also essential, ensuring that the chairs remain safe and functional over time.

Cost-Effectiveness of Rotomolding Chairs Compared to Traditional Manufacturing

Rotomolding chairs offer significant cost advantages over traditional manufacturing methods. The production process allows for complex shapes with minimal waste. According to a report by the Society of Plastics Engineers, rotomolding can reduce material usage by up to 30% compared to injection molding. This efficiency leads to lower costs, making rotomolding an attractive option for manufacturers and buyers alike.

Furthermore, rotomolding equipment tends to have lower initial investment costs. The machinery for rotomolding is often less expensive and requires smaller operational footprints. According to industry analyses, companies can save 20-40% on equipment costs. This makes the entry barrier lower for small and mid-sized businesses to produce durable furniture, enabling a wider variety of options in the market.

However, there are challenges to consider. Rotomolded products may have longer lead times. This could delay usage for businesses needing immediate supply. Moreover, some manufacturers may struggle with quality control compared to conventional methods. Still, the benefits of cost savings and design flexibility often outweigh these potential drawbacks for many global buyers.

Environmental Impact: Sustainability Features of Rotomolded Chairs

Rotomolded chairs are gaining attention due to their environmental benefits. These chairs are made from durable polyethylene, which is recyclable and reduces waste. The manufacturing process of rotomolding uses less energy than traditional methods, contributing to lower carbon emissions. This eco-friendly approach appeals to buyers focused on sustainability.

Choosing rotomolded chairs means opting for products that can last for years. Their sturdy design withstands outdoor conditions, reducing the need for replacements. This longevity translates to less material consumption over time, making a significant difference in environmental impact. Buyers should consider the lifecycle of products when making a choice.

When selecting rotomolded chairs, check if the manufacturer offers recycling options. Look for products designed with minimal waste in mind. It's also helpful to inquire about the production processes. Many companies are now transparent about their sustainability practices, which builds trust. Understanding a product's entire journey can help buyers make more informed, eco-conscious decisions.
